From bed97f49c6cccd0075a133836f6e4fae825a2bc1 Mon Sep 17 00:00:00 2001 From: Peter Savchenko Date: Tue, 17 May 2022 22:23:31 +0300 Subject: [PATCH] use data instead of config --- src/index.js | 30 ++++++------------------------ 1 file changed, 6 insertions(+), 24 deletions(-) diff --git a/src/index.js b/src/index.js index ecee605..9abc60b 100644 --- a/src/index.js +++ b/src/index.js @@ -536,44 +536,26 @@ class Header { { icon: '', title: 'Header 1', - config: { - defaultLevel: 1, + data: { + level: 1, }, }, { icon: '', title: 'Header 2', - config: { - defaultLevel: 2, + data: { + level: 2, }, }, { icon: '', title: 'Header 3', - config: { - defaultLevel: 3, + data: { + level: 3, }, }, ]; } - - /** - * Returns current active toolbox entry - * - * @returns {ToolboxItem} - */ - get activeToolboxEntry() { - const activeToolboxItem = Header.toolbox.find(toolboxItem => toolboxItem.config.defaultLevel === this.currentLevel.number); - - if (activeToolboxItem) { - return activeToolboxItem; - } - const activeSettingsItem = this.levels.find(level => level.number === this.currentLevel.number); - - if (activeSettingsItem) { - return { icon: activeSettingsItem.svg }; - } - } } module.exports = Header;